So I'm getting on this plane and already made a few friends prior so thus far not a biggie. I take a seat at the wing where MnM said it would be the least jumpy and off we go. I tried to sleep but I was way too excited at this point. Finally at the halfway mark I ask the guy next to me for the time. He doesn't have a clue but asks the attendant and from there "David" and I became friends. It helped the time go by and relaxed me a bit. He is married and has kids and so we had a few things in common. (A bit of a jokester though as he added a few things to my fears each time the plane jumped.)
Okay we finally hit Albuquerque and he walks me to my next gate and we part. I jump on the phone to yap w/ my MnM while I spend 2 hours hanging out. Stop and play w/ a baby for a bit, bought my favorite Rum Lifesavers (I can never find those here) and waited to get on the plane. Finally it's boarding time and I decide I want to sit up close so when we land I can run off and into his arms. I sit in row 2 with a single little boy who has his head down. Seems harmless enough so why not. UNTIL they serve the peanuts. He's struggling with his bag so I offer to help and from there on I couldn't find a freakin' off button on this child. He's 8, he spent a few weeks in Lubbock w/ grandma, he has $15 left out of $90 and his mom will be so proud. He was going to see the Jonas Brothers concert the next day and today he's starting an ice skating camp. I can go on if you'd like... lots more to tell about little Jake, really.
So as little man and I are talking it dawns on me that we aren't heading to Ontario but instead Phoenix? WTF! Then the sky goes dark and we start bumping around. I hear the captain announce that he wants all his people sitting and buckled ASAP and just when I'm about to wet my freakin' pants the little monkey next to me throws his arms up into the air and yells "I love when roller coasters go upside down"!!
AAAAAAAAAAHHHHHHHHH!!!!!!!!
So we finally land and all the Phoenix people get off when the captain comes back on and lets us all know that the plane is unable to fly any farther due to mechanical issues (yeah no crap) and that we all need to haul booty to some other gate on the other side of hell to load on another plane. On your mark, get set, go!
I'm panting as I'm chasing this woman with hopes not to get lost. BTW her name ended up being Kim and we became ***** buddies real fast! So we get to the other gate and there's no plane. Finally some guy walks up and says the weather is so bad that no one can come in or out and that we may as well sit a while. GGRRR!!! Double GGRRR!!!
Wait Wait Wait Wait... hours go by and we still wait. Kim, Ryan (he was going to Salt Lake) and I yapped the entire time. We watch the rain fall, lightning strike and some dumb nut head driving a big employee bus take out a golf cart. (That was the highlight). Finally they announce for us to line up that we get to leave. We all stand and rush the gate waiting for the magic door to open when here comes little man with the great news. "Sorry folks but there is damage to this aircraft and it is unable to depart". AAUUGGHH!!
Someone announces snacks and drinks and feeling rather light headed we decide to head over. Grab a few OJ's and some snack bar thing and go to sit down when we see a large crowd fly by. I jumped in front of someone and asked if this was our flight and she said YES so away we went. We managed to get up to the front and yep, you guessed it, we had to wait. AND WAIT AND WAIT! FINALLY the guy says give me your name if you were a bumped passenger and I'll check you off. We file on and Kim is ahead of me but saves me a nice up front seat. Then the flight attendant gets on, after everyone is finally seated, and says "we do not have ice and it will take up to an hour to get some... who wants to wait"? Now this woman must have been feeling pretty bold 'cause there were more than a few ppl ready to unbuckle and tackle her down. I hear someone yell "screw the ice" and the plane begins to leave... until it suddenly gets a bit quitter. The pilot comes out and said there was luggage forgotten and in order to load it the engine on one side had to be shut off. OMG OMG OMG are we ever gonna leave!
FINANALLY he gets the okay and we start to go and just as I see plane after plane just lined up on the runway he says "Looks like it may take a while to get out of here". I'm not sure but it was about an hour before we left the ground. It was just a crazy, bumpy, wild ride. I kept looking at Kim asking if this was normal and she just shook her head with great big eyes. She flies all the time so that did NOT give me a warm and fuzzy. Eventually we hit the ground and with a big screech! I called MnM to tell him but he was already watching. See apparently they don't let anyone come to the airside to greet passengers unless you're a big, strong, and really angry Mountainman! He was the lone soul there and just for me. WHEW! What a flight... we didn't get back to the house until after 3am his time which meant I'd been up for about 24 hours.
Yeah it took a LOT to get back on another plane after this one.
